  • Bank and Credit Card Reconciliation

    Ever found yourself scratching your head, wondering why your bank statement does not rather match your internal records? This typical conundrum is specifically what reconciliation addresses. It's the process of comparing your service's monetary records with those of your bank or charge card business to guarantee they match. This isn't practically capturing mistakes; it's about recognizing possible fraud, unrecorded deals, or even easy clerical errors. A timely reconciliation can be the distinction in between a minor misstep and a major monetary headache. It resembles double-checking your work before submitting, using comfort and financial integrity.

  • Financial Reporting

    Beyond the everyday grind of entries and reconciliations, the true value emerges in the reports. These are your organization's monetary narrative, telling a story of its health and efficiency. Key reports include:

    • Revenue & & Loss (Earnings Declaration): A snapshot of your earnings, expenses, and revenues over a duration.
    • Balance Sheet: A view of your assets, liabilities, and equity at a specific point in time.
    • Capital Statement: Information how money is created and used by your organization.

    These reports are not just historic files; they are powerful tools for tactical decision-making, assisting you determine trends, chances, and areas for enhancement. Types of Accounting Systems: A Much Deeper Dive

Ever found yourself staring at a pile of receipts, questioning if there's a better method? The truth is, the best bookkeeping system isn't practically organizing documents; it's about building a robust financial foundation for your company. When considering bookkeeping services, comprehending the underlying systems is critical. Lots of companies, specifically start-ups, often begin with a cash-basis system, where income is tape-recorded when received and expenses when paid. It's basic, simple, and for sole proprietors or really little organizations without stock, it can suffice. However, can you genuinely grasp your financial health if you're not tracking what you're owed or what you owe others?

Then there's the accrual basis, a far more sophisticated technique that lines up profits with the period in which it's made and expenditures with the duration in which they're sustained, regardless of when money modifications hands. Imagine a consulting company completing a project in December but not getting paid up until January. Under accrual, that earnings is acknowledged in December, offering a much clearer image of that month's performance. This method is generally needed for larger companies and those carrying stock, providing a more precise representation of profitability and possession appraisal. Think of it as the distinction in between a snapshot and a motion picture; the latter provides much more context and information.

Single-Entry vs. Double-Entry: The Fundamental Divide

The distinction between single-entry and double-entry accounting is fundamental. Single-entry belongs to a checkbook register, tracking ins and outs in a single column. It's uncomplicated, definitely, but its simplicity is likewise its biggest constraint. There's no integrated system for error detection, nor does it offer a thorough view of your monetary position beyond capital. It resembles attempting to browse an intricate city with only a street map; you may get by, however you'll miss out on a great deal of crucial details.

Double-entry, alternatively, is the gold requirement for a reason. Every deal impacts at least 2 accounts, one a debit and one a credit, maintaining the accounting equation: Possessions= Liabilities + Equity. This intrinsic balance serves as a built-in mistake detection system. If your debits do not equivalent your credits, you know there's an inconsistency. This approach enables the development of essential monetary statements like the balance sheet, income statement, and cash circulation declaration, offering a holistic view of your organization's monetary efficiency and position. It's the distinction between thinking and understanding, in between reacting and planning. For professional accounting services, double-entry is generally the chosen methodology, using the accuracy and insight companies really require to flourish.
